The material contains video footage of individuals (faces, parts of the body) and speech. The material also contains conversations between individuals, mainly related to work tasks but also partly to personal life. The material may contain sensitive personal data that could not be removed from the video or audio recording without compromising the research use of the material.
Direct personal data appearing in the text-based transcripts of the material, e.g., names of people and workplaces, have been pseudonymized.
Situations related to teamwork and/or interaction related to audio description were selected for this resource. Visually impaired adults, adults with normal vision and audio description professionals, mainly in work situations, were selected as the research subjects. In the subcorpus ’mutable-art’, individuals in the aforementioned groups were also recorded partly in their leisure time (a museum visit would be a work situation for audio describers and personal assistants, but leisure time for other participants).
